Is talking on a mobile phone hazardous to your health?It is difficult to know for sure.Some research suggests that heavy users of mobile phones are at a greater risk of developing brain tumors.However,many other studies suggest there are no links between cancer and mobile phone use.
The main problem with the current research is that mobile phones have only been popular since the 1990s.As a result,it is impossible to study the long-term exposure of mobile phone use.This concerns many health professionals who point out that many cancers take at least ten years to develop.Another concern about these studies is that many have been funded by those who benefit financially from the mobile phone industry.
Over three billion people use mobile phone on a daily basis,and many talk for more than an hour a day.Mobile phone antennas are similar to microwave ovens.While both rely on electromagnetic radiation,the radio waves in mobile phones are lower in radio frequency(RF).
Microwave ovens have enough RF to cook food and are therefore known to be dangerous to human tissues.However,the concern is that the lower frequency radio waves that mobile phones rely on may also be dangerous.It seems logical that holding a heat source near your brain for a long period of time is a potential health hazard.Mobile phones get hot when they are phoned for a long period of time.
Some researchers believe that over types of wireless technology may also be dangerous to human health,including laptops,cordless phones,and gaming consoles.Organizations that are concerned about the effects of Electromagnetic Radiation(EMR)suggest replacing all cordless devices with wired ones.They say that many cordless phones emit dangerous levels of EMR even when they are not in use.They even suggest keeping electronic devices,such as computers and alarm clocks out of bedrooms,or at least six feet from your pillow.
Other wireless technology may also be hazardous to our health.A growing number of professionals worldwide are recommending that mobile phone users should use their phones carefully until more definitive studies can be conducted.They recommend that adults use headsets or speaker phones and that children and teens,whose brain tissues are still developing use mobile phones only for emergencies.Concerned medical experts use the example of tobacco to illustrate the potential risks.Many years ago,people smoked freely and were not concerned about the effects of cigarettes on their health.Today people know that cigarettes cause lung cancer,though it is still unknown exactly how or why.Some doctors fear that the same thing will happen with devices such as mobile phones.
